Benefits of CNC Turning

CNC turning provides a number of advantages compared to manual turning operations:

Precision and Accuracy – CNC machines offer extremely tight tolerances down to +/- 0.005 in for dimensional accuracy and repeatability. This high level of precision enables manufacturing complex geometries.

Efficiency – CNC automation allows turning operations to run 24/7 with minimal operator intervention. The increased efficiency results in higher production volumes and faster turnaround times.

Complexity – CNC turning can manufacture geometries impossible to produce manually, including parts with intricate features, blind holes, and micro shapes.

Low Cost – CNC turning is very economical compared to other machining processes, keeping per-part costs down even for small lot sizes.

Material Versatility – CNC lathes can turn a wide range of materials including metals such as stainless steel, aluminum, brass, titanium, and engineered plastics.

Finishing Capabilities – Many CNC turning operations can include finishing processes such as threading, grooving, drilling, and tapping in a single setup.

For these reasons, manufacturers of all sizes rely on CNC turning to produce tight tolerance metal and plastic turned parts from prototypes through high-volume production.

CNC Turned Parts for the Medical Industry
The medical equipment manufacturing and biotech industries rely on expert CNC turned parts suppliers to produce the tight tolerance components needed for surgical instruments, implants, diagnostic equipment, and lab instrumentation.

Delicate materials including stainless steel, plastics like PEEK, and specialty alloys must be machined to exact specifications to fulfill biocompatibility, sterilization, and extended product life requirements. Critical factors for medical CNC turned parts include:

- Biocompatible and sterilizable materials
- Extremely tight tolerances
- Validation of all machining processes
- Clean room assembly
- Post-process passivation and electropolishing
- Extensive quality control testing and inspection

Brass CNC Turning Specialists
Brass parts benefit from CNC turning due to brass’s machinability, corrosion resistance, electrical and thermal conductivity, and gold hue appearance. Common uses for precision CNC turned brass components include:

- Electrical connectors, couplings, terminals
- Plumbing fittings and valves
- Food and beverage packaging and handling equipment
- Decorative trim and lighting components
- Sensitive instrumentation

When choosing a precision brass CNC turning shop, look for experience with alloys like yellow brass, naval brass, and red brass in threaded, grooved, and chamfered geometries.
